본문 바로가기
반응형

전체 글38

ISTQB 표준 용어 ISTQB 표준 용어 1. V-모델 : V 모델(V-model)은 소프트웨어 개발 프로세스로 폭포수 모델의 확장된 형태 중 하나로 순차적 개발 수명주기 모델 상세한 문서화를 통해 작업을 진행. 또한 테스트 설계와 같은 테스트 활동을 코딩 이후가 아닌 프로젝트 시작 시에 함께 시작하여, 전체적으로 많은 양의 프로젝트 비용과 시간을 감소시킨다. * 순차적 개발 모델에서 모든 단계는 이전 단계가 완료될 때 시작돼야 한다. 2. 결정 커버리지 : 각 조건문이 True 혹은 False가 되는 조건이 모두 테스트되는 정도를 측정하는 척도 결정 테스팅은 결정 커버리지를 늘리기 위해 특정 조건문의 분기를 테스트하는 테스트 케이스를 도출하는 과정 * 결정 커버리지는 구문 커버리지 달성을 보장한다. 그러나 반대의 경우는 .. 2024. 1. 5.
ISTQB_FL_2018v.3.1_샘플문제_A_v1.7_한글_v0.1 (오답) ISTQB_FL_2018v.3.1_샘플문제_A_v1.7_한글_v0.1 1. 테스트 컨디션(Test Condition) 이란 하나 또는 그 이상의 테스트 케이스에 의해 검증될 수 있는 항목 또는 이벤트. 테스트 베이시스(basis)로 파악된 컴포넌트나 시스템의 실행 가능한 측면 * 테스트 베이시스(basis) : 요구사항을 내포하고 있는 모든 문서. 테스트 케이스는 테스트 베이시스(basis)를 토대로 만들어 진다. - 테스트 분석 : 무엇을 테스트할 것인가 ㄴ 요구사항 명세. 비즈니스 요구사항, 기능 요구사항, 시스템 요구사항, 사용자 스토리, 에픽, 유스케이스 ㄴ 기능/비기능 컴포넌트나 시스템 동작이 명시된 유사 작업 산출물 ㄴ 설계와 구현 정보. 시스템이나 소프트웨어 아키텍처 다이어그램, 설계 명세,.. 2024. 1. 1.
[데이터통신] OSI 7계층 프로토콜 총정리 개방형 시스템 상호연결 참조 모델 7계층 Layer 1 : 물리 계층(Physical layer) : 디지털 데이터를 아날로그적인 전기적 신호로 변환하여 물리적인 전송이 가능케 한다. - 주요 프로토콜 : X.21, RS-232 Layer 2: 데이터링크 계층(Data link layer) : 네트워크 카드의 MAC(Media Access Control)주소를 통해 목적지를 찾아간다. - 주요 프로토콜 : HDLC, X.25, Ethernet, TokenRing, DFFI, FrameRelay Layer 3: 네트워크 계층(Network layer) : 호스트로 도달하기 위한 최적의 경로를 라우팅 알고리즘을 통해 선택하고 제어한다. - 주요 프로토콜 - IP, ARP, ICMP(오류보고, 상황보고, 경로.. 2023. 9. 20.
CKA 자격증 - Certified Kubernetes Administrator 6편 [Labels & Selectors] Labels 이란? 쿠버네티스(Kubernetes) Label은 쿠버네티스 클러스터 내의 리소스를 식별하고 그룹화하기 위한 메타데이터 속성입니다. 리소스에 레이블을 부여하여 해당 리소스를 특정 기준에 따라 분류하거나 그룹화할 수 있습니다. 이를 통해 리소스를 더 쉽게 관리하고 식별할 수 있으며, 애플리케이션의 배포, 관리, 모니터링 등에 활용됩니다. 각 Label은 키-값 쌍으로 구성되며, 리소스에 여러 개의 Label을 부여할 수 있습니다. 예를 들어, "app=frontend", "environment=production"과 같이 다양한 속성을 가진 Label을 리소스에 추가할 수 있습니다. Selector 란 쿠버네티스(Kubernetes)에서 Selector는 Label을 기반으로 리소스를 선택하.. 2023. 8. 16.
CKA 자격증 - Certified Kubernetes Administrator 5편 [Namespace] Namespace 란? Kubernetes의 Namespace(네임스페이스)는 클러스터 내에서 리소스들을 구분하고 격리하는 논리적인 공간입니다. Namespace를 사용하면 여러 사용자 또는 팀이 하나의 Kubernetes 클러스터를 공유하더라도 서로 다른 리소스 그룹을 생성하고 관리할 수 있습니다. Namespace를 사용하면 리소스 이름의 충돌을 방지하고, 리소스를 논리적으로 구분하여 리소스 관리와 접근을 향상시킬 수 있습니다. 1. Service 정보 출력 $ kubectl get namespace $ kubectl get ns # 모두 동일한 결과를 출력 해당 명령은 Kubernetes 클러스터 내에 정의된 모든 Namespace(네임스페이스)의 목록을 조회하는 명령입니다. 이 명령을 사용하여 클.. 2023. 8. 15.
CKA 자격증 - Certified Kubernetes Administrator 4편 [Service] 쿠버네티스 Service 란? Kubernetes에서의 Service는 클러스터 내에서 실행 중인 파드(Pod)에 접근하기 위한 네트워크 추상화를 제공하는 리소스입니다. Service는 Pod의 동적인 IP 주소나 이름을 추상화하고, 일관된 방법으로 서비스에 접근할 수 있는 로드 밸런싱 기능을 제공합니다. 이로써 파드가 생성, 삭제, 업데이트될 때도 애플리케이션의 가용성과 안정성을 유지할 수 있습니다. * 네트워크 추상화란 : 네트워크 추상화(Network Abstraction)는 복잡한 네트워크 상황을 단순화하고 관리하기 쉽게 만들기 위해 사용되는 개념입니다. 이를 통해 사용자나 개발자는 네트워크 세부 사항을 신경 쓰지 않고도 원하는 기능을 구현하고 사용할 수 있습니다. 1. Service 정보 출력.. 2023. 8. 10.